跳转到内容

Trading session

Trading Session – 阻止开仓模块,将在开仓和平仓时间之外阻止开立订单。

示例:我们设置模块只在 09:00 到 15:00 之间开立订单。模块阻止从下午 15:00 到第二天早上 09:00 之间开立订单。因此,如果您将交易时段设置为 09:00 到 15:00 之间,则允许在 9:30 或 10:00 开立订单,但不允许在 18:00 或 06:00(交易时段之外)开立订单。在此示例中,如果 Open Signal(Open Buy / Open Sell)在 09:10 激活,则模块不会阻止订单开立。

您需要确保根据您经纪商的服务器时间正确设置时间。您可以在 MetaTrader 的 Market Watch 顶部或添加 EA 后在图表的左上角找到您当前经纪商的服务器时间。

订单将在这些时间内或时间外由平仓 Signal 和模块关闭;此模块不会自动关闭订单,也不会阻止订单被关闭。只能添加 1 个此类型的模块。此模块可以与 Trading Session Exclusion 模块配合使用。

  • Start Hour (servertime):开始开立新订单/仓位的小时(使用 0-23)。设置为 13 等于下午 1 点。
  • Start Minute (servertime):开始开立新订单/仓位的分钟(0-59)。
  • Stop Hour (servertime):停止开立订单/仓位的小时(使用 0-23)。
  • Stop Minute (servertime):停止开立新订单/仓位的分钟(0-59)。

您可以按天设置模块是否影响您的 EA(周一、周二、周三、周四、周五、周六或周日,按服务器时间)。因此,如果您只启用周一并将交易时间设置在 09:00 到 15:00 之间,那么您的交易时间仅在周一受到影响。在其他所有日子,您的 EA 将能够在需要时随时交易。如果您需要在其他日子禁止交易,请同时添加 Trading Session Exclusion 模块。